This chapter is divided into five parts: (1) Background and Theoretical Framework of the study, (2) Statement of the Problem and the Hypothesis, (3) Significance of the Study, (4) Definition of Terms, (5) Delimitation of the Study.

Part One, Background and Theoretical Framework of the Study, includes the potential contribution of the study, the background information and the framework of the study.

Part Two, Statement of the Problem and the Hypothesis, indicates the purpose of the investigation generally and specifically using both descriptive and inferential questions.

Part Three, Significance of the Study, includes the benefits to be derived from the results of the study.

Part Four, Definition of Terms, alphabetically lists and defines difficult words or terms used in the study for clarity and understanding.

Part Five, Delimitation of the Study, gives the brief and concise scope or boundaries of the study.
